Fighting 'not a debate within the game'

By Scott Burnside
ESPN.com

Monday, March 9, 2009

NAPLES, Fla. -- Want to know why the debate over fighting in the National Hockey League will never be resolved? It's because, for the most part, people in the NHL don't see that there's a debate about fighting at all. Fighting is part of the game. Has been since the days when they used frozen horse dung and curved tree branches. Move along, people. Nothing to look at here.
